About Al Khawarizmi International College
Al Khawarizmi International College, located in Marawi City within the Bangsamoro Autonomous Region in Muslim Mindan, Philippines, was established in 1985 as a pioneering institution aimed at providing quality higher education in a region marked by cultural diversity and resilience. Named after the renowned mathematician Al-Khwarizmi, the college focuses on fostering innovation in fields like information technology, business administration, health sciences, and engineering. Its mission is to empower students and professionals through accessible, high-quality education that addresses local and global challenges, particularly in post-conflict reconstruction and sustainable development in Mindanao. Key achievements include partnerships with international organizations for skill development programs and a strong emphasis on vocational training, making it a vital contributor to the region's economic growth. The main campus in Marawi City features modern facilities, including labs and libraries, despite historical challenges like the 2017 siege, which the institution has resiliently overcome. The college's history reflects a commitment to inclusivity, serving a diverse student body from Muslim, Christian, and indigenous communities. It has produced graduates who excel in IT, healthcare, and business sectors, contributing to national development. Notable departments include Computer Science, Nursing, and Business Management, with a focus on research in digital innovation and community health.
